Larva of Bonellia setting near the probosics of adult female develops into male due to :

A

electrolytes in water

B

oxygen in enviroment

C

substance secreted by probosics

D

carbon dioxide in the environment

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C

According to F. Baltzer (1935) environment determines sex in a marine echiuroid Bonellia viridis .The proboscis produce a hormon-like substance that influences the development of male characters.
